Ah I think might be moving too much,just duck a little bit keep ur hands to ur ears like ur trying doing ear muffs, ur not trying too get them to completely hit air just not flush and also ur gloves reduces damage even more. And watch their timing, if u feel overwhelmed jump back or clinch, but try to get one clean strong hit, if u get them right they go ugly right away and they can’t see, then u side step and fire away. It does take practice, im still not great but can see the improvements, like u can see their face clearer and ur punches connect better, dont get discouraged, it takes time, just dont care about winning try to work on certain aspects

If they are spamming they usually have huge openings, if they knock you out in two punches I don’t consider that spamming. How are we defining spamming, two consecutive hooks? If it’s normally spamming like a ton of hook volume u need to just get good at accuracy, I find I can throw one hook for every three to four hooks they throw, if it lands accurately u will knock them out way before they do. If you consider all hooks spamming then idk what to say. If you really don’t want to throw hooks then please tell me u have space and not doing phone booth or joystick. Footwork also beat spamming u just run around them. FYI im not great but dealing with spammers never been an issue.

If u have mirror then u def updated, ur having trouble even with single player? The bots are pretty easy for me in normal settings, are you able to get combinations on the bots? Mirror probably works because ur getting automatic counter hits. For bots try feint jab wait for their block then cross body hook right hook. Not sure if u do combinations but they work really well with the current version at least against bots. As a side note dummy damage doesn’t translate when it changes to an actual fight, like your movements aren’t exactly the same when facing a moving target, it takes some getting used to.

Only my opinion so take it or leave it. I think it depends on the person which why I think there’s so many different opinion, some ppl are just pretty habitual and not adaptive. So it’s like picking up a completely different style, like if you learned bjj, Muay Thai, boxing, etc. each will put some bad habits into the other if you are trying to get really good at each. Like if u do boxing more u probably leave your selves open to leg kicks when you go into Muay Thai. But if u just want boxing it’s mostly how disciplined you are, like u care about winning so much that u found out this glitch that lets u win more, but has nothing to do with boxing r going to use it? I hear plenty of ppl that box that enjoy the game i think just depends on u. But if you box a lot i feel that ur boxing habits should be more than stable enough to not have a vr game overwrite them, unless you stop training in boxing. I’m just saying i would just be surprised for a top level boxer that trains regularly to start playing this game, and then suck irl boxing solely bc of this game, like apply irl boxing into the game not the other way around even if it doesn’t work, it’s still a moving target, I mean if your willing to shadow boxing, this is a great tool just how you use it, but maybe that’s just me.
